1. Roomba j7+ from iRobot

The Roomba J7+ is iRobot's most intelligent robot vacuum to date. Its biggest breakthrough is its camera-based obstacle detection system that makes use of built-in AI to recognize objects like charging cords, shoes, and the pet waste that most other robots can't avoid (and often plough right through). It's also the first to automatically send you a picture of any object it encounters so you can tell it to avoid it in the future.

The Combo J7+ is the most efficient mop robot we've ever tested, removing dirt and spills with ease and leaving no trace that it was there. It's easy to control using the iRobot Home app which lets you schedule cleaning and create Keep Out Zones to ensure it doesn't clean areas you do not want it to. It's compatible with Alexa or Google Assistant so you can start it and stop it with a voice.

Its design is superior to the rest with a sleek top piece that looks more like a toy robot than a loud, obnoxious one. The Clean Base Automatic Dirt Disposal System is self-emptying which is great to speed up cleaning.

In our tests, we found that the j7+ swiftly eliminated dirt, dust and pet hair. The counter-rotating rubber brushes held the debris in place instead of scattering it across the floor. It was able to capture small pieces of gravel, sand, and even a bit of grit. Most robots could not achieve this feat. It did all this without getting caught in our pet's hair shedding.

Although it's not as sophisticated as the $1,217 Roomba s9+ Self-Emptying Vacuum and can't clean stairs, the j7+ is still a solid option for those who need both a vac and a mop in their home. It's not too expensive, and the iRobot application makes it user-friendly to use.

Although the iRobot Home app is very user-friendly however, we've found it to be less reliable than other applications that work with robotic floor vacuums cleaners. It can take some time to download updates and it's sometimes difficult to determine whether they're functioning until you actually witness them in action.

2. Roborock Q5+

If you're looking for a vacuum that does more than just clean floors, the best choice is probably one that is a hybrid. These robots come with a water tank, so they can vacuum and mop simultaneously. They also have a number of additional features, such as smart mapping, small obstacles avoidance, and even the capability to wash and dry mopping pads. The disadvantage is that they can be expensive when purchased at full retail, but on Black Friday and Cyber Monday they are often reduced in price.

Roborock makes some of our most loved robot vacuums and the Q5+ isn't an exception. It's their cheapest auto-empty model, and while it's not equipped with some of the features you'll find on higher-end models (like no-go zones and multi-story memory) it's still an excellent option if you're willing compromise a bit in order to save hundreds of dollars.

The Q5+ is notably gentle around obstacles such as tables and walls, which makes it a great choice for homes with lots of furniture. It is also very thorough in removing dust bunnies. This is a place where many robot vacuums that are less expensive do not excel in. The navigation technology in the Q5+ is superb and has very few missing in corners and along walls.

3. Narwal Freo X Ultra

The Freo X Ultra is a well-rounded cheap robot vacuum cleaner mop and vacuum that's astonishingly intelligent in its vacuuming and mopping capabilities. Its design is one of the best in the industry however, it's costly.

Its base station looks good and is easily hidden when not in use, and the size is relatively compact. But the station's main selling feature is the way it automatizes various tasks and functions that other robots leave up to you. It can store clean and dirty water, electrolyzes and heats the water (which many other robots require you to do) and empty the dust bin after vacuuming, and helps keep your robot fully charged and clean.

Its vacuuming capabilities are also impressive. It's one of the few robot vacuums I've tested that does very well at cleaning up debris from plain floors, and is not nearly as loud as the more expensive Roomba 980 or iRobot the 900 series.

But the Freo X Ultra has its faults, especially when it comes to navigation. Its laser sensors and LiDAR sensors aren’t as reliable as other robot vacuums. This means that it could get stuck or get confused in certain corners or rooms in the home. It's not able to climb stairs as well as some competitors, for instance and doesn't come with a dock that allows you to create an exclusive cleaning zone for plush carpets.

The Freo X Ultra robot vacuum and mop is an excellent choice for those who want a robot vacuum that does it all.

4. eufy RoboVac G30

Eufy, a Anker company, has a track record of making robot vacuums that strike the right balance between performance, features and price. The G30 Hybrid offers a powerful cleaning on hard and carpeted flooring, and mopping capabilities at an affordable price. It's easy to set up simply by snapping one of the side brushes on, turn on and plug in the charging dock. The app walks you through several steps to connect it to Wi-Fi, and the G30 is ready to go. You'll need to leave the dock near a power outlet and enough space for it to move however.

The G30 is a small device that measures 2.85 inches in height, meaning it can be tucked away under couches and pieces of low-clearance furniture. Its design is more subtle when compared to rival models. It has a sleek black finish with three buttons that are physical for Auto Cleaning start/pause (which scrubs the area in a spiral pattern for two minutes) Recharge, and Spot Cleaner. You can also connect the G30 with Amazon Alexa or Google Home for voice commands to perform unscheduled cleaning.

The primary feature that sets the G30 apart from its competitors is the method it cleans. It makes use of an integrated map to draw a picture of the immovable objects in its path. It keeps track of what it has already cleaned and what it is unable to access. When it needs to recharge, it automatically returns to its starting point and begins cleaning from where it started.
